The Golden Goose Superstar, initially unveiled in 2007, represents a pivotal moment for the brand, introducing the iconic star patch and the now-signature distressed aesthetic, diverging from the prevailing clean sneaker styles. This innovative design drew inspiration from the rugged charm of skate culture, embodying the look of well-worn skate shoes. The 'Dream Maker' iteration specifically enhances this narrative, emphasizing personalization by enabling wearers to customize the shoe by cutting away the outer layer to reveal hidden details, thus making each pair a unique expression of its owner.

The 'Dream Maker' Superstar is a low-top sneaker, distinguished by its two-material upper: an outer layer of white cotton designed to be cut, revealing a white leather base beneath, which features hidden messages and details. This design is complemented by distressed accents, rubber trim, printed leather, and suede or ponyhair trim on certain variants. Its interior boasts a genuine leather insole, offering enhanced heel support molded for the left and right feet, while the outsole features a hand-stained rubber sole, with some versions showcasing a herringbone pattern or a star logo.
